Abstract
Housing corporations are an important actor in the Dutch housing market. A parliamentary investigation showed there were a lot of incidents within the housing corporations. In this thesis I examine what the current role of the housing corporations is in the Dutch housing market and I question whether a case can be made for its privileged position based on the level of earnings management. To answer this question I use OLS regression analysis and I examine the 2011 annual reports of the housing corporations. The regression is based on financial information of 2011 provided by the Orbis database. The outcome is of this study is that housing corporations engage less in real based earnings management than purely market based firms
